Unusual Odors You Can't Identify

Pests often leave behind distinct odors that can be a strong indicator of their presence. For instance, cockroaches can produce a musty or oily smell, while rodents may leave a urine odor. Even certain insects like bed bugs can emit a sweet, sometimes almond-like scent in larger infestations. If you notice persistent, unexplained odors in your home, especially in areas like forgotten corners of the basement, behind appliances, or within wall voids, it's wise to consider the possibility of a hidden pest problem. These smells are often a consequence of their waste products, pheromones, or even decomposing bodies, none of which you want lingering in your living space.

Droppings or Excrement

One of the most common and undeniable signs of a pest infestation is the presence of droppings. Rodent droppings are typically small and pellet-shaped, varying in size depending on whether you're dealing with mice or rats. Insect droppings, like those from cockroaches, can resemble coffee grounds or black pepper. Finding these in your pantry, cabinets, under sinks, or along baseboards is a clear indication that pests are actively foraging in your home. Gnaw Marks or Damaged Property

Pests, particularly rodents and some insects like termites and carpenter ants, can cause considerable damage to your property. Gnaw marks on electrical wires, baseboards, furniture, or food packaging are classic signs of rodent activity. Wood damage, such as sagging floors, hollow-sounding wood, or mud tubes on walls (indicating termites), signifies potential structural issues caused by wood-destroying pests. Ignoring these signs can lead to expensive repairs down the line. Increased Allergenic Symptoms

For some individuals, unexplained allergic reactions or an increase in existing allergy symptoms might be linked to a pest infestation. The shed exoskeletons, droppings, and even saliva of certain pests, such as cockroaches and dust mites (which can be exacerbated by pest issues), can act as allergens, triggering respiratory problems, skin rashes, or other allergic responses. The Unwanted Arrival of Bed Bugs

Bed bugs are a growing problem not just in Glens Falls but globally. These tiny, elusive pests feed on human blood and can be transported unknowingly into your home through luggage, used furniture, or even on clothing. Once established, they are incredibly difficult to eliminate without professional intervention due to their ability to hide in tiny cracks and crevices and their increasing resistance to some common pesticides. Signs of bed bugs include small, itchy red bites, blood spots on sheets, and tiny black or rust-colored spots (bed bug excrement). Bed bug eradication requires specialized knowledge and treatment methods, such as heat treatments, which penetrate areas where traditional sprays cannot reach. Termites: The Silent Destroyers

Termites are insidious pests that can cause significant structural damage to a home without residents even knowing they are present. These wood-destroying insects silently consume cellulose material, weakening the wooden components of your house frame, flooring, and walls. By the time signs of termite activity become apparent, such as sagging floors, hollow-sounding wood, or mud tubes on the foundation, considerable damage may have already occurred.
